ABOUT SIAMESE CATS
These attractive, blue eyed cats make wonderful companions and family pets. They are known to be very talkative and will happily hold a long conversation with their owners whenever they can. They are athletic, lithe, medium sized cats that thrive on human company.
​
The Siamese tends to be rather demanding and does not like to be left on their own for any length of time. As such, they are best suited to households where at least one person stays at home most of the time. They are real extroverts and enjoy the company of another Siamese cat, more especially if they have grown up together in the same household.
​
They are very intelligent, with loads of energy. They need to be kept busy and therefore it’s important to invest in good quality toys and scratching posts, it’s also important to spend time playing with them because Siamese thrive on as much human attention as they can get.

Kittens
All our kittens are raised indoors underfoot in a busy household. They are played with and handled every day to ensure they are properly socialised and used to all household noises.
They are registered with the GCCF as Non Active.
They come with 5 weeks insurance, toys, food, and a blanket. They will be fully vaccinated, microchipped, de-flead, wormed and vet checked twice before leaving, which is usually around 13/14 weeks of age. We take our responsibility towards kittens that we breed very seriously and offer a lifetime of free advice and support, should you need it.
